Output 18c2c379cf819886a60950df979f2038cf66bb4af235c9a343c3699d922664f6:1

value
376900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cafd22367277143a635bbe1b3b2313141df7f9 OP_EQUAL
address
3DXJGCWKp98BUmqx8sCJctpuPw3tZBnKvT
transaction
18c2c379cf819886a60950df979f2038cf66bb4af235c9a343c3699d922664f6
spent
true